    What exactly is a Smart Grid!

    “A true Smart Grid enables multiple applications to operate over a shared, interoperable network, similar in concept to the way the Internet works today.” comments Katie Fehrenbacher in an earth2tech article http://earth2tech.com/2009/01/26/faq-smart-grid/, quoting Foundation Capital's note on the market.

    Cisco Systems is the leading champion of the whole Smart Grid initiative, "The smart grid augments the electricity network with sensors, controllers, data communications, computers and software to distribute energy with greater economy, efficiency, reliability and security. New technology increasingly makes possible the extension of the smart grid all the way to residential users and even into their homes.", comments Larry Lang, vice president and general manager of the Services and Mobility Business Unit at Cisco Systems.
